Senate: Homeland Security, Justice, Public Safety

Earle B. Ottley Legislative Hall St. Thomas

Agenda: The committee will conduct a hearing to receive updates from the Virgin Islands Territorial Emergency Management Agency (VITEMA) and the Virgin Islands National Guard (VING) regarding their preparedness for the 2018 hurricane season. Boards of Election to Convene

Elections Systems Offices St. Thomas and St. Croix

The Board of Elections has scheduled a meeting that will address the General Election Ballot approval and other election related matters. It will be held via videoconference between ESVI St. Croix Office at Sunny Isle Annex Unit 4 and ESVI St. Thomas Office at Lockhart Gardens Shopping Center (above Banco Popular)

WAPA Board Emergency Meeting

WAPA’s Al Cohen Conference Room St. Thomas

The Governing Board of the Virgin Islands Water and Power Authority will hold an emergency meeting. AGENDA (Action items) (a) Contract for Major Disaster Assessment and Recovery Services (b) Contract for Tree Trimming Services

Veterans Drive Parade for 9/11

Emile Griffith Ballpark to Emancipation Garden St. Thomas

Water Island Administrator Merwin C. Potter has announced the temporary closure of Veterans Drive east bound lanes in Charlotte Amalie. This closure will commemorate the 17th anniversary of the 9/11 attacks.
